Nursing home seized for illegal abortions in Warangal

Warangal Urban: Medical and Health department officials seized Akshya Nursing Home, Kothawada, in Warangal city for carrying out illegal abortions.

On receiving information about the illegal abortions, the authorities inspected the nursing home at midnight on Tuesday and found a 16-year-old girl and a woman waiting for abortion at the hospital. “We conducted ‘Panchanama’ in the presence of revenue, police and child protection officers and sealed the hospital since there was no doctor and no proper maintenance of records,” said District Medical and Health Officer (DMH) Dr K Lalitha Devi in a press note here on Wednesday.


The hospital management violated the Telangana Allopathic Private Medical Care Establishments (Registration and Regulation) Act, 2002 and The Medical Termination of Pregnancy (MTP) Act, 1971. “We admitted the girl and the woman at CKM Hospital as they were already given pills for abortion,” the DMHO added.

Additional DMHO Dr T Madanmohan Rao, District Surveillance Officer Dr Sri Krishna Rao, Warangal Tahsildhar Mohammed Iqbal, Sub-Inspector Srinivas Reddy, DEMO V Ashok Reddy, CDPO Vishwaja,  staff of Integrated Child Protection Scheme (ICPS) Srinivas, Supervisor Viplav Kumar and J Ramesh participated in the inspection.
